Created by the Center for Creative Leadership (CCL), this flagship leadership development experience has been in use for 30 years and is recognized around the world for excellence in leadership development. In a 2008 Financial Times survey, the Center earned an overall Top 10 ranking worldwide among providers of executive education for the fourth consecutive year.

Based on the most recent leadership research, our leadership development training uses a variety of in-depth self-awareness tools and activities to enhance leadership capabilities. Participants learn strategies for continuous development through extensive assessment, group discussions, self-reflection, small-group activities and personal coaching.  LDP alumni typically describe this leadership development training as the most transformational development experience they have ever had, both personally and professionally.  Over 6,000 leaders have participated in LDP at Eckerd College.

Who Should Attend

Mid- to senior-level managers who want to strengthen their leadership effectiveness through a feedback-intense learning experience.

Outcomes

During this program, participants

  • Give and receive feedback more effectively
  • Practice leading organizational change
  • Develop others
  • Manage self
  • Leverage differences in other people
  • Set clear, achievable goals

 Special Features

Each participant receives a confidential one-on-one session with a certified CCL feedback coach to review the results of the week and to begin setting clearly defined goals.

A carefully structured peer feedback session, in-depth, 360-degree feedback, and videotaped sessions help develop coaching and interpersonal skills.

Experiential and small-group activities throughout the week maximize learning and provide an opportunity to practice giving and receiving feedback.

Immediately following the program, a ten-week Web-based follow-up goal management system allows participants to further their learning objectives and discuss their progress with a CCL feedback coach and/or other LDP participants.

Three months after the program, participants complete a follow-up assessment to measure behavioral changes since attending LDP.
